The Concept of Value
What is Value?
Value, according to Marx, is derived from the labor invested in producing a commodity. It’s not just about the material costs but the human effort involved.
Use-Value vs. Exchange-Value
- Use-Value: The practical utility of a commodity.
- Exchange-Value: The market value of a commodity, determined by the amount of labor required to produce it.

Profit: The Surplus Value
Understanding Profit
Profit, in Marxian terms, is the surplus value created by workers but appropriated by capitalists. It’s the difference between the value produced by labor and the wages paid to workers.
Surplus Value
Surplus value is generated when workers produce more value than they receive in wages. This excess is the source of profit for capitalists.
The Labor Theory of Value
Labor as the Source of Value
Marx’s labor theory of value posits that all value is created by labor. The more labor invested in a commodity, the higher its value.
Exploitation of Labor
Marx argued that capitalism exploits workers by paying them less than the value they produce. This exploitation is the root of profit.
Implications for Capitalism
Class Struggle
The capitalist system, according to Marx, is characterized by a fundamental conflict between the working class (proletariat) and the owning class (bourgeoisie).
Capital Accumulation
Capitalists reinvest profits to accumulate more capital, perpetuating the cycle of exploitation and inequality.
Economic Crises
Marx believed that capitalism is inherently unstable, leading to periodic economic crises due to overproduction and underconsumption.

Critiques of Marx’s Theories
Criticisms of the Labor Theory of Value
Some economists argue that value is subjective and influenced by consumer preferences rather than solely by labor.
Alternative Theories
Neoclassical economics offers different perspectives on value, price, and profit, focusing on supply and demand rather than labor.
